Karen has 2 1/8 gallons of apple juice and 4 1/4 gallons of orange juice in her refrigerator. how many gallons of juice does karen have altogether in her refrigerator? a student solved the problem this way: 2 1/8 + 4 1/4 = 2 1/8 + 4 2/8 = 6 3/8 karen has 6 3/8 gallons of juice. use a similar strategy to solve this problem. adam has 4 1/3 gallons of apple juice, 3 5/9 gallons of orange juice, and 3 1/2 liters of soda in his refrigerator. how many gallons of juice does adam have altogether in his refrigerator?
a. 7 2/3 gallons
b. 7 5/6 gallons
c. 7 2/9 gallons
d. 7 8/9 gallons
